FAQs
Why should I consider replacing my air conditioner now?
Upgrading your air conditioner can lead to improved efficiency, lower energy costs, and enhanced comfort in your home. Older units tend to work harder to cool your space, which can lead to increased wear and tear, higher energy bills, and frequent repairs.
How can I tell if my AC unit is inefficient?
Signs of inefficiency include rising energy bills, inconsistent cooling, unusual noises, and the age of the unit. If your air conditioner is over 10-15 years old, it may be time to consider a replacement, as newer models are much more energy-efficient.
What are the benefits of a more efficient air conditioning unit?
The primary benefits include lower energy costs, reduced environmental impact, improved indoor air quality, quieter operation, and enhanced comfort. Upgraded models often come with advanced features like smart thermostats and more effective filtration systems.
How can I prepare for an air conditioning replacement?
To prepare, you should research the best models for your needs, consider the size of your home, and evaluate your budget. It's also beneficial to consult with a professional technician who can help assess your specific requirements and guide you in making an informed choice.
Will replacing my AC unit be disruptive?
While the replacement process can create some inconvenience, most installations can be completed within a day. Professional technicians strive to be efficient and minimize disruption to your daily life, ensuring your home cools down as quickly as possible.
What should I look for in a new air conditioning unit?
Key factors to consider include the unit's SEER rating (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io), size and capacity compatible with your space, additional features (like smart technology), and warranty options. It's also essential to choose a reputable brand known for reliability and efficiency.

Are there incentives available for upgrading to a more efficient unit?
Many utility companies and government programs offer incentives, rebates, or tax credits for upgrading to energy-efficient appliances. It’s worth researching local programs to see if you can take advantage of any financial benefits.
Do I need to do anything to maintain my new AC unit after installation?
Yes, regular maintenance is key to prolonging the life and efficiency of your new air conditioning unit. This includes changing filters, scheduling annual professional inspections, and keeping the outdoor unit clear of debris and obstructions.
